RHEL 10 – kolejna wersja komercyjnego Linuxa

10 czerwca, 2025

20 maja zaprezentowano najnowszą wersję systemu Red Hat Enterprise Linux, czyli popularnej komercyjnej dystrybucji, która znalazła zastosowanie szczególnie w środowiskach wymagających wsparcia technicznego, ale też pewnej stabilności w zakresie obowiązywania wsparcia. Nowa wersja nie różni się znacząco od poprzednich – nie wprowadzono innowacyjnych funkcjonalności. Można zapoznać się z artykułem na blogu firmy Red Hat, w którym krótko opisano najważniejsze zmiany. Natomiast po więcej informacji na temat samego RHEL odsyłam do mojego poprzedniego wpisu.

Z praktycznej perspektywy kluczowe wydaje się zaprzestanie wsparcie dla architektury x86-64-v2. Już w wersji RHEL 9 przy starcie systemu pojawiał się komunikat Deprecated. Obecnie w RHEL 10 wspierana jest wyłącznie co najmniej architektura x86-64-v3. Nie można uznać tego za znaczącą zmianę, ponieważ procesory obsługujące x64-64-v3 produkowane były od 2013 roku – jeszcze w procesorach Intel Haswell.

Okno instalacji Red Hat Enterprise Linux
Okno instalacji Red Hat Enterprise Linux

W oparciu o Red Hat Enterprise Linux powstają też bezpłatne alternatywy (równie dobrze sprawdzające się w profesjonalnych zastosowaniach), które zachowują binary compatibility – te same pakiety będą działały poprawnie w każdym systemie. Na ten moment jest już dostępny system AlmaLinux 10, a prawdopodobnie wkrótce będzie można spodziewać się kolejnej wersji Rocky Linux. Systemy RHEL można zaktualizować do nowszej wersji z użyciem narzędzia Leapp. Nie ma jednak powodów, aby możliwie szybko przeprowadzać cały proces. Przede wszystkim RHEL cechuje się długim, wynoszącym aż 10 lat, okresem wsparcia – dla porównania w Ubuntu pełne wsparcie jest na okres 5 lat (kolejne 5 lat obejmuje tylko aktualizacje związane z bezpieczeństwem). Z tego powodu jest częstym wyborem w dużych środowiskach korporacyjnych czy w administracji publicznej.

Przykład niekompletnego tłumaczenia w procesie instalacji
Przykład niekompletnego tłumaczenia w procesie instalacji

Dodatkowym argumentem przemawiającym za rozsądniejszym wyborem czasu aktualizacji jest niedostępność nowych wersji wybranego oprogramowania w RHEL 10. Nie jest to duża ilość pakietów, ale przykładowo nie ma jeszcze dostępnej aktualizacji serwera MySQL.

Działanie Leapp — aktualizacja pakietów w dedykowanym środowisku
Działanie Leapp — aktualizacja pakietów w dedykowanym środowisku
Zakończenie procesu aktualizacji
Zakończenie procesu aktualizacji

W celu aktualizacji Red Hat Enterprise Linux 9 do wersji 10 wystarczy zainstalować pakiet leapp-upgrade-el9toel10 i wykonać standardowo leapp upgrade. Narzędzie poinformuje o ewentualnych wykrytych problemach uniemożliwiających aktualizację. W plikach logów znajdą się też rekomendacje rozwiązania znalezionych błędów. Do przeprowadzenia migracji wymagana jest aktualna subskrypcja (możliwość pobrania pakietów z repozytoriów Red Hat). Dobrą praktyką jest wcześniejsze wykonanie przynajmniej snapshota maszyny, aby w razie niepowodzenia dostępna była możliwość płynnego przywrócenie działającego stanu.

Czy ten artykuł był pomocny?

Oceniono: 2 razy

Picture of Michał Giza

Michał Giza

Administrator systemów Linux i Windows Server. Konfiguruje serwery WWW, bazy danych i inne usługi sieciowe. Wykonuje i automatyzuje wdrożenia aplikacji internetowych.
Picture of Michał Giza

Michał Giza

Administrator systemów Linux i Windows Server. Konfiguruje serwery WWW, bazy danych i inne usługi sieciowe. Wykonuje i automatyzuje wdrożenia aplikacji internetowych.

PODZIEL SIĘ:

guest
0 komentarzy
najstarszy
najnowszy oceniany
Inline Feedbacks
View all comments

[ninja_tables id=”27481″]

\r\n <\/div>\r\n<\/div>\r\n","isUserRated":"0","version":"7.6.30","wc_post_id":"56364","isCookiesEnabled":"1","loadLastCommentId":"0","dataFilterCallbacks":[],"phraseFilters":[],"scrollSize":"32","url":"https:\/\/avlab.pl\/wp-admin\/admin-ajax.php","customAjaxUrl":"https:\/\/avlab.pl\/wp-content\/plugins\/wpdiscuz\/utils\/ajax\/wpdiscuz-ajax.php","bubbleUpdateUrl":"https:\/\/avlab.pl\/wp-json\/wpdiscuz\/v1\/update","restNonce":"e0b82d7925","is_rate_editable":"0","menu_icon":"https:\/\/avlab.pl\/wp-content\/plugins\/wpdiscuz\/assets\/img\/plugin-icon\/wpdiscuz-svg.svg","menu_icon_hover":"https:\/\/avlab.pl\/wp-content\/plugins\/wpdiscuz\/assets\/img\/plugin-icon\/wpdiscuz-svg_hover.svg","is_email_field_required":"1"}; var wpdiscuzUCObj = {"msgConfirmDeleteComment":"Are you sure you want to delete this comment?","msgConfirmCancelSubscription":"Are you sure you want to cancel this subscription?","msgConfirmCancelFollow":"Are you sure you want to cancel this follow?","additionalTab":"0"}; -->